Having lived in Baltimore for almost a year, I’ve explored quite a few spots! Here’s my honest take on some popular restaurants in the city: 1. Loch Bar 🦪 📍 Inside the Four Seasons Hotel, Inner Harbor A seafood-focused bar with great outdoor seating (though a bit pricey 💸). Oysters & Clams: Fresh and delicious – I preferred the clams for their texture! Mussels: Spicy broth + bread = perfection! Crab Cake: Packed with lump crab meat – truly a Maryland standout! Vibe: Upscale, lively, perfect for special occasions. 2. Cinghiale 🇮🇹 📍 Waterfront Italian fine dining Impeccable service and a lovely outdoor setting with harbor views. Duck Breast: Cooked perfectly with well-balanced sides and sauce. Tiramisu: Classic and delicious (sorry, no photo!). Verdict: Solid but not mind-blowing – great for dates or celebrations. 3. Lebanese Taverna 🌿 📍 Inner Harbor A Lebanese restaurant I tried out of curiosity (despite my cilantro aversion 😅). Lamb Shank: Tender and flavorful – a highlight! Curry: Good, but overloaded with cilantro (avoid if you’re not a fan!). Price: Reasonable for the area. Note: Great for Middle Eastern cuisine lovers! 4. Maximón 🇲🇽 📍 Also in the Four Seasons A stylish Mexican restaurant with creative dishes. Wagyu Tacos: Tasty but oddly presented on a bed of corn (looked like bird feed 🐦…). Duck Tacos: Unique and delicious with fresh avocado salsa. Braised Short Rib: Melt-in-your-mouth goodness – worth the price! Verdict: A bit expensive, but the ambiance and food make it a repeat-worthy spot.
